Is no return no exchange policy legal in the Philippines?
Note that a “No Return, No Exchange” Policy is prohibited because this is considered deceptive. Under the Consumer Act, in conjunction with the New Civil Code of the Philippines, sellers are obliged to honor their warranties and grant corresponding remedies to consumers.
Can you return items in the Philippines?
Consumer rights According to Republic Act 7394 or the Consumer Act of the Philippines, consumers have the right to have any purchased item be returned, exchange, and refunded if the items are deemed broken or defective.
Can I exchange item without receipt Philippines?
Q: Can a buyer return defective goods without the official receipt? A: The Official Receipt is the best proof of purchase. However, he/she may still demand replacement or refund if he/she can prove that a defective item was bought from a certain store.

Is no return no exchange valid?
Q: Why is the presence of a “No Return, No Exchange” notice considered deceptive? A: Such statement is considered deceptive because consumers may return or exchange the goods or avail of other remedies, in case of hidden faults or defects, or any charge the buyer was not aware of the time of purchase.
What is RA 7394 consumer Act of the Philippines?
The Philippine government adopted RA 7394 (Consumer Act of the Philippines of 1991) as the legal basis for consumer protection in the country. The law embodies the state policy on the protection of consumers and establishes standards of conduct for business and industry in the country.

What is the Department of Trade and Industry No Return no exchange policy?
Below is your guide to understanding the most often ignored policy of the Department of Trade and Industry – the No Return, No Exchange Policy. The “No Return, No Exchange” or ANY equivalent tag line is NOT ALLOWED to be posted in stores nor written in the official receipt of ANY business transaction.
Can the prohibition on “no return no exchange” be invoked?
If after buying a certain item, a customer changes his mind and wants to return said item, can he invoke the prohibition on “No Return, No Exchange”? No, the prohibition is not an excuse for the consumers to return the goods because of a change of mind.
